Який формат 24-годинного часу в MySQL?
MySQL використовує 'ГГ:ХХ:СС' формат для запиту та відображення значення часу, яке представляє час доби, що знаходиться в межах 24 годин. 25 лютого 2022 р.
У наведеному вище запиті SQL ми використовуйте системну функцію MySQL now(), щоб отримати поточну дату й час. Потім ми використовуємо речення INTERVAL, щоб вибрати ті рядки, де order_date знаходиться в межах останніх 24 годин від поточної datetime. Замість того, щоб вказувати інтервал у годинах, ви також можете вказати його в днях.
Значення параметрів
Формат | опис |
---|---|
%M | Повна назва місяця (з січня по грудень) |
%м | Назва місяця як числове значення (від 00 до 12) |
%W | Повна назва дня тижня (з неділі по суботу) |
%T | Час у 24-годинному форматі (гг:хх:сс) |
Спробуйте strtotime, який отримує мітку часу Unix для будь-якого англійського формату дати/часу. Якщо це не працює з коробки, можливо, додайте довільний день перед рядком часу, який ви передаєте. Тоді ви можете використовуйте strftime для перетворення мітки часу у 24-годинний формат.
MySQL розпізнає значення TIME у таких форматах: Як рядок у 'D hh:mm:ss' формат. Ви також можете використовувати один із таких «розслаблених» синтаксисів: 'hh:mm:ss' , 'hh:mm' , 'D hh:mm' , 'D hh' або 'ss' .
Тип ЧАС MySQL використовує 'ГГ:ХХ:СС' формат для запиту та відображення значення часу, яке представляє час доби, що знаходиться в межах 24 годин. Для представлення інтервалу часу між двома подіями MySQL використовує формат «ГГГ:ХХ:СС», який перевищує 24 години.